Chevalier is a tier-one supplier specialising in advanced technology systems primarily for the automotive industry. Our products include Safety-Critical Systems, Access Control, Power Actuators, and Control Electronics. Our products are fitted to a considerable number of top-of-the-range passenger and supercars worldwide.

We are a small team of software engineers looking to expand. We are in search of a competent Software Test Engineer to take on the development of new features and carry out testing/validation of software developed by our contractors.

  • At least 3 years experience in Software Testing
  • Extensive experience in C programming
  • Knowledge of debugging and software test strategies
